275 ft. is no problem if you use proper RG-59. Make certain you get high-quality RG-59 with 100% pure copper center conductor and at least 95% braided copper shield. Do not use CATV cable, which uses clad center conductor (copper-coated steel) and aluminum shield.

what do we need to avoid when running the cables? to avoid hum bars?

That's hard to say since you never really know if you are going to have a ground loop issue. The best I can tell you is keep the cable as far away from power wires as possible and if you have to cross them, do it at a 90 degree angle. Also try to attach the cameras to non-conductive surfaces where possible.

There is no simple answer for this but the rule of thumb is 250m for RG59u. This is for pure copper , 95% braided shielding & 0.9mm centre conductor. But there are other things that may impact on that. The 1 vpp composite signal level is only a nominal level & not all cameras will have that output , some will be lower. A black/white composite signal will generally be around 4.7Mhz while a colour will be around 5.5Mhz. Thus the colour signal will have ever so slightly more attenuation. (not a lot but may be important over max runs - read on ) After the coax the most important item is the DVR I/P circuitry. All DVR inputs will have signal/noise discrimination circuitry. This is the bit that determines if bona fide video signal is present or if it is just noise. There is a threshold that if not reached the DVR will determine there is video loss and respond accordingly. This level is determined by the received sync level , the white signal level and the colour burst (chroma + luma ) level of the received composite signal.

 

Generally it is accepted that with "quality cable" the following maximun distances are used-

RG59u (7.9 db /m @ 50 Mhz) 250 m

RG6u (4.9 db/m @ 50 Mhz) 350m

RG11u (4.3 db/m @ 50 Mhz) 500m

 

Keep in mind that the physical size of the cable increases as the performance increases & can be a problem in itself. For longer distances there are a number of techniques that can be used such as amplifiers , equalisers & compression devices if the buget allows for them.

sir surtech in case the signal cables run parallel with the power lines, how far should the separation of this two wires to avoid any interference?

 

The induced noise (hum) will be dependant on the EMR of the field surrounding the powered cable & this is dependant on the current in that cable. So for a cable supplying a 60W light globe you could run parallel for quite some distance with no ill effect while for a 415 v 200A welder circuit you would want it as far away as possible. The quality of your components (DVR , coax etc) also comes into play.
